Advanced Ventilation: Fresh Air Without Energy Loss

Heat Recovery HVAC systems represent the gold standard in modern climate technology, designed to bridge the gap between indoor comfort and external air quality. Unlike traditional systems that simply recirculate stale air, Heat Recovery units capture thermal energy from outgoing exhaust air and use it to pre-condition incoming fresh air.

What is a ducted air conditioning system

A ducted air conditioning system is a whole-home climate control solution that uses a central unit and hidden ducts to efficiently cool or heat every room, offering consistent comfort and energy-efficient performance.

What is Ducted Air Conditioning Systems?

Ducted air conditioning uses a central system and concealed ceiling ducts to heat or cool your entire home. It delivers consistent, energy-efficient comfort throughout every room, with the added flexibility of controlling different zones from a single system.

A central indoor unit conditions the air, which is then delivered through ducts to vents in each room. A controller or thermostat lets you set temperatures and manage zones throughout your home.

Zoning allows you to control the temperature in different areas of your home independently. This improves comfort and can reduce energy costs by only conditioning the spaces you’re using.
